The British Security Industry Association, Information Destruction Section

BSIA logo

The BSIA ID Section was formed in April 2000, when NAID UK , the Nationwide Association for Information Destruction, merged with the BSIA to form a new section on information destruction.

The BSIA is Britain ’s biggest security association and many of Britain ’s leading security companies are long term members. All members must have UKAS-approved ISO9001:2000 quality certification and sign up to their own specific industry code of practice and/or ethics.

Shortly after merging, the new BSIA ID Section started work on a revised code of practice that would eventually become a new British Standard on the destruction of confidential information, to be known as BS8470, and due for release to the wider public in the Summer of 2006.

The new British Standard concentrates more on the service element of business, such as cctv systems; collection, movement and storage; and less on the physical side of destruction, though there is some guidance on destruction and shred sizes.

The BSIA ID Section now has around 30 member companies from all parts of Britain , giving almost a nationwide coverage.
